Tumlinson, Anna – 1989
The Tombigbee Regional Library in West Point, Mississippi, conducted a literacy program from October 1, 1988 to September 30, 1989. During the period, the program recruited 166 students and 64 new tutors, provided funding for 110 students not eligible for Job Training Partnership Act funding, solicited and used community resources and funds, and…

Sherry, Diana – 1989
The Boulder Public Library offered a one-to-one free literacy program aimed at middle-class nonreaders. During the fiscal year October 1988 to September 1989, the program matched 60 new students with volunteer tutors; of these, 52 enrolled, boosting enrollment to 90 students.
